Nintendo's Virtual Game Cards Enhance Game Sharing
Nintendo has announced the introduction of Virtual Game Cards, a new feature for both the Switch and the upcoming Switch 2, launching in late April. This feature allows digital games to be shared similarly to physical game cartridges, enabling users to 'eject' and 'load' digital games onto different consoles with a one-time local wireless setup. Games can be shared between two systems per account or lent to family group members for up to two weeks, but only one game per family member is allowed. An internet connection is required for the initial setup. The new system aims to enhance digital game sharing and ease the transition to the Switch 2, which will support backward compatibility. This development is viewed as a significant step in improving the gaming experience ahead of the Switch 2's release.
